My Take
Bradley Wiggins fascinates me because he refused to be defined by a single discipline. He built his foundation on the track, then reinvented himself for the road and, in 2012, became the first Briton to win the Tour de France, sweeping up the BBC honour and a knighthood in the same golden year. What strikes me is the quiet, almost stubborn intelligence behind those results, a man who let the legs do the talking. Born in Ghent yet utterly British in spirit, he is one of those athletes whose achievements speak louder than any interview ever could.

Awards & achievements
- 2008 Commander of the Order of the British Empire
- 2012 BBC Sports Personality of the Year Award
- 2012 Knight Bachelor
- 2012 Vélo d'Or
